CompositeActivity.Dispose(Boolean) Método

Definição

Chama Dispose(Boolean) nesta instância e, opcionalmente, chama Dispose() todas as atividades filhos desta instância.

protected:
 override void Dispose(bool disposing);
protected override void Dispose(bool disposing);
override this.Dispose : bool -> unit
Protected Overrides Sub Dispose (disposing As Boolean)

Parâmetros

disposing
Boolean

true libertar tanto os recursos geridos como os não geridos usados por esta instância e por todas as atividades filhos desta instância; false para libertar apenas os recursos não geridos desta instância.

Observações

Ao longo da vida útil de uma atividade, vários objetos .NET podem ser criados ou eliminados. Sempre que uma instância de workflow é descarregada da memória, os objetos .NET correspondentes às atividades na árvore de workflow são eliminados (o método Dispose é chamado em cada atividade). Quando a instância do fluxo de trabalho é carregada novamente na memória, é criado um novo objeto .NET para cada atividade com o estado do descarregamento correspondente.

Aplica-se a